About Adam
Adam Wyville focuses on restructuring and commercial litigation at TGF, where he first joined as a summer student and later completed his articling term. He has collaborated with firm lawyers on matters in both of TGF's core practice areas, preparing written submissions for cases before Ontario's Superior Court of Justice and its Court of Appeal. A 2024 graduate of Osgoode Hall Law School, he competed for Osgoode at the Oxford Price Media Law Moot, winning the Americas round and placing fourth overall as an international oralist, and also took part in the Gale Cup Moot while earning writer-of-the-year honours at a student-run legal publication.
